About Lydney
Lydney is a small town located in Gloucestershire, England, within the GL15 postcode area. It lies near the River Severn and is surrounded by the scenic beauty of the Forest of Dean. The town has a mix of residential areas and local shops, providing essential services for its residents. Lydney is also known for its marina, which offers opportunities for boating and fishing along the river.
The town has a railway station that connects it to nearby cities, making it accessible for visitors. Lydney Park is a notable attraction, featuring Roman ruins and a pleasant garden, inviting those interested in history and nature to explore. Household Income in Lydney ONS 2023
The average total household income in Lydney is approximately £50,255 a year before tax, 9%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£37,475.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Lydney ONS 2025
There are approximately 878 active businesses based in Lydney, around 38 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 90%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 10 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Lydney
Of the 10,192 households in and around Lydney, 74% are owned, 13% are socially rented and 12%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ering Lydney.
